What โ€œEfficiencyโ€ Really Means in 24/7 Crypto Mining

Before looking at hardware, we need to break down what makes a GPU truly efficient.

Hashrate-to-Watt Ratio

A strong hashrate means nothing if the GPU draws insane power. High efficiency = high hashrate at the lowest possible wattage.

To compare GPUs properly, miners look at:

  • MH/s per watt
  • Performance under undervolted settings
  • Real-world efficiency after thermal adjustments

Why GPUs Still Matter in 2025 (Even With ASIC Dominance)

Even with ASIC miners dominating certain algorithms, GPUs still hold significant value.

Flexibility Across Coins

ASICs mine only one algorithm. GPUs mine dozens.

You can pivot between:

  • Ethash
  • Kawpow
  • Autolykos
  • Zhash
  • ProgPow

Common GPU Mining Hardware Issues & Fixes

Thermal Throttling

Occurs when the GPU hits high temperature thresholds.

Fix by:

  • Lowering clocks
  • Improving airflow
  • Adding cooling pads

VRAM Overheating

Mainly affects NVIDIA 30-series.

Tips:

  • Replace thermal pads
  • Improve backplate cooling
  • Add direct airflow

Fan Wear & Mechanical Noise

Fans degrade after constant use.

FAQs

1. What is the most efficient GPU for 24/7 crypto mining?

The RTX 4070 Super is often considered the best balance of efficiency, power draw, and stability.

2. Which GPU has the best ROI for beginners?

The RTX 3060 Ti and RX 6700 XT offer excellent ROI for small and mid-scale miners.

3. Do GPUs wear out faster from 24/7 mining?

Yes, but with proper cooling and undervolting, lifespan can remain extremely long.

4. Are AMD GPUs still good for mining in 2025?

Definitely. Cards like the RX 7900 XTX and 7800 XT deliver strong efficiency for modern algorithms.

5. How important is undervolting for mining?

Itโ€™s essential. Undervolting drastically reduces heat, power consumption, and long-term wear.

6. How many GPUs can I run in one rig?

Most miners run 6โ€“12 per rig depending on their power supplies, space, and airflow setup.

7. Should I choose an ASIC instead of a GPU?

Choose ASICs for single-algorithm mining. Choose GPUs for flexibility and multi-coin mining.
